Transaction 23bb2a00e84f755f36a8bf996536e138d295062686c4a24c92b641b5cd3c50bc

1 Input
2 Outputs
  • 23bb2a00e84f755f36a8bf996536e138d295062686c4a24c92b641b5cd3c50bc:0
  • value  304723
    address  17sQVcQidPsNW7EHj2DPwawFoRigrfPs2z
  • 23bb2a00e84f755f36a8bf996536e138d295062686c4a24c92b641b5cd3c50bc:1
  • value  925
    address  1HmLonSTg2bnPYdUfX1aLmYWi7Ucbdmvrn